Output 87abbbe0d558c8d539a14faebf2c97165dd75d7bf908cd182bbe91491f91759e:0

value
51742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f10c4ed3a9bc8791f647b813aa2c1108a2381194 OP_EQUAL
address
3PfZWwhkgEDp5isW4ZEoPX6fNpVEHKNR6s
transaction
87abbbe0d558c8d539a14faebf2c97165dd75d7bf908cd182bbe91491f91759e
confirmations
263153
spent
true